Abstract
A surgical instrument comprising an elongate shaft assembly operably supporting a circular surgical staple cartridge in a distal end thereof and a plurality of arcuate tissue acquisition members pivotally attached to the elongate shaft assembly and configured to be selectively radially deployable from a first position wherein the plurality of arcuate tissue acquisition members cooperate to form a continuous ring defining a continuous outer ring diameter and a second deployed position wherein each arcuate tissue acquisition member extends radially outward from the elongate shaft assembly is disclosed. The surgical instrument further comprises means for selectively deploying the plurality of arcuate tissue acquisition members between the first position and the second deployed position, a tissue cutting member comprising two diametrically opposed ends forming a plurality of tissue cutting edges, and means for selectively rotating the tissue cutting member relative to the plurality of arcuate tissue acquisition members.
